  • Unexpected Character: The vast majority of the cast come from the Touhou games, but the show likes to throw some curveballs now and then:
    • Despite his canon Touhou appearances being limited to side material (most notably being the main character in Curiosities of Lotus Asia)note , Rinnosuke gets to host the show. Starting from the 3rd competition, he's also a recurring contestant despite still being the host.
    • Kasen participates in the 8th competition, which was released at a time she was a manga-only character.
    • The 8th competition features a team consisting of Akyuu and Kosuzu, both of whom are print works-only characters.note 
    • The 13th entry has Okina team up with the Fortune-teller, an obscure Forbidden Scrollery character who only appears in two chapters. Eiki's version of the 15th contest features two more minor Forbidden Scrollery characters in the Alcoholic Junkies team.
    • The co-host of Keiki's version of the 15th contest is Miyoi, whose only appearance at the time was her main role in Lotus Eaters, which was then the second most recent manga.
